<p>Louise Smith, age 82, of Ellijay, Georgia, passed away peacefully on June 16, 2026. She was born on December 24, 1943, to the late E.B. and Frances Shirley.</p><p><br></p><p>Louise was a devoted woman who loved her family and friends dearly. She found joy in life's simple pleasures, especially playing bingo, working in her yard, gardening, and canning the fruits of her labor. She was happiest when she was caring for others, always putting the needs of family, friends, and neighbors before her own. Her nurturing spirit and generous heart touched countless lives throughout the years.</p><p><br></p><p>Known affectionately by those who loved her as a true "pistol ball," Louise was feisty, determined, and full of life. She was a fighter and a survivor who faced life's challenges with strength, courage, and an unwavering spirit. Her quick wit, resilience, and loving nature made her unforgettable to all who knew her.</p><p><br></p><p>Above all, Louise cherished her family and treasured every moment spent with them. Her love, strength, and caring heart will continue to live on in the lives she touched. She will be remembered with love and greatly missed by her family and friends.</p><p><br></p><p>In addition to her parents, she was preceded in death by her husband, Buddy Smith; daughter, Judy Givens; son, Allen Smith; several brothers and sisters.</p><p><br></p><p>Louise is survived by her daughter, Donna Johnson (Ken); grandchildren, Jeremiah Johnson (Heather), Joseph Johnson (Lindsay), JoAnna Sumner (Justin), Chris Givens (Carrie) and Megan Givens; thirteen great-grandchildren, Andrew, Bradley, Patrick, Lincoln, Bennett, Faith, Evie, Aidyn, Gracie, Zoey, Logan, Olivia and Kiera; siblings, Bobby Shirley, Amos Shirley, Linda Knowles, Geneva Waters, Annette Weaver and Buddy Shirley; as well as a host of nieces, nephews, cousins and friends.</p><p><br></p><p>Funeral services will be held at 2:00 p.m. on Saturday, June 20, 2026 at the Sosebee Memorial Chapel with Rev. Trammel Rhodes officiating. Interment will follow in Chalcedonia Baptist Church Cemetery. The family will receive friends at the funeral home on Friday, June 19th from 3:00 p.m. until 9:00 p.m. and Saturday, June 20th from 11:00 a.m. until the funeral hour.</p><p><br></p><p>In lieu of flowers memorial donations may be made to Children's Healthcare of Atlanta at choa.org.</p><p><br></p><p>Sosebee Funeral Home, Canton, Georgia is honored to serve the family of Louise Smith.
